Tex-Mex Tuna Tacos
Instruments
- 1/3 cup low-fat sour cream
- 1 tbsp freshly squeezed lime juice
- 1 tsp taco seasoning mix
- 1 tbsp minced red onion
- 1 tbsp chopped fresh cilantro or flat-leaf parsley
- 1 can (6 oz / 170 g) chunk light tuna in water, drained
- 4 taco shells
- Toppings
- Chopped green onions
- Diced tomato
- Diced avocado
- Shredded cheddar cheese
Lyrics
In a medium bowl, whisk together sour cream, lime juice and seasoning mix. Stir in onions, cilantro and tuna. Season with salt and pepper. If possible, refrigerate for an hour to allow the flavors to meld.
Fill tacos with tuna mixture and sprinkle on toppings.
Volume: Makes 4 tacos
